State Sues Half Moon Bay Over Housing Plans | Oakland News

California is suing five cities—including Half Moon Bay—for ignoring state housing laws that require updating housing plans every eight years. Despite submitting drafts and meeting some requirements, these cities still lack necessary rezonings, prompting legal action. Officials call the delays arbitrary and unlawful, while Half Moon Bay’s mayor says the city is making progress and is surprised by the lawsuit.
